The Brit Oval: Surrey
Lighting control and energy management
This world famous sports ground has had a networked lighting control system introduced throughout the new stand and building to control the lighting in the concourse and circulation areas. The system provides lighting control with added power saving efficiencies by the use of a centralised control system being networked to intelligent relay modules throughout the building and external areas. The system has been set-up to be fully automatic, although the user can control various functions of the lighting from the touch screen controllers, which have been provided in the reception.

KC Stadium: Hull City AFC
Lighting control and energy management
Lighting control of pitch and circulation areas is featured to achieve energy and installation savings. The system reduced the average lighting installation by around 30% due to the use of the systems technological advances, whilst the energy figures are typically reduced by 25%.

John Charles Centre For Sport: Leeds
Lighting control and energy management
The indoor lighting control for this multi purpose sports arena relies on automatic light level monitoring to maintain competition requirement, with a centralised control for ease of operation and installation; features that are consistent with a modern approach to building management.
